Egress window installation services involve the process of adding or enlarging windows that meet specific size and design requirements to serve as emergency exits in a property. These windows are typically installed in basement or lower-level areas to provide a safe escape route in case of emergencies. The installation process includes cutting into existing foundation walls or floors, framing the opening, and fitting the window unit to ensure proper operation. Proper installation ensures that the window meets safety standards and functions effectively as an emergency exit, contributing to the overall safety of the property.

Material and Window Type Costs - The expense of egress window installation varies based on the materials and window style chosen. Typical costs range from $1,500 to $4,000, with some high-end options exceeding this range. Local pros can provide estimates tailored to specific preferences and property conditions.
Labor and Permitting Expenses - Labor costs for installing an egress window generally fall between $1,000 and $3,000, depending on the project's complexity. Permitting fees may add an additional $100 to $500, varying by local regulations and property specifics.
Additional Excavation and Finishing Costs - Excavation, foundation work, and finishing touches can influence the overall price, often adding $500 to $2,000. The extent of excavation needed depends on basement conditions and site accessibility.
Total Project Cost Estimates - Overall, the total cost for egress window installation typically ranges from $2,500 to $7,000. Costs vary based on scope, location, and specific project requirements, with local service providers offering detailed quotes.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is an egress window? An egress window is a large window designed to provide an emergency exit from a basement or lower level, complying with safety standards.
Why should I consider installing an egress window? Installing an egress window can enhance safety by providing a clear escape route in case of emergencies and can also increase natural light and ventilation.
What types of egress windows are available? Common options include casement, sliding, and double-hung windows, each suitable for different basement setups and aesthetic preferences.
